About the School
[/et_pb_text][et_pb_text _builder_version=”4.3.2″ hover_enabled=”0″]
HKUST Business School is a part of The Hong Kong University of Science and Technology in Hong Kong, China. It is considered to be one of the world’s foremost business schools in Asia. Established in 1991, this B-school is one of the first Asian business school to be accredited by both the US-based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B International) and the European Quality Improvement System (EQUIS)

HKUST Business School offers three variations of an MBA course:
Full-time MBA Program
This 16-month program includes internships and overseas exchange and students also can choose the 12 months accelerated program.
Part-Time MBA Program (Weekly Mode)
In this program, classes are held at weekends for helping students maintain a work and study balance.
Part-Time MBA Program (Bi-Weekly Mode)
In this program, classes are conducted bi-weekly.

HKUST Business School offers scholarships entirely based on merit. The school provides equal opportunity to all nationalities, professions, gender, and age. Candidates do not have to submit any separate application for scholarships as it will be considered along with the admission. Regarding the criteria, the Scholarship Committee takes a holistic approach in making the decision, including admission interview performance, career background, GMAT/GRE score, and academic qualification.

There are three essays that candidates will have to prepare:
Essay 1: The HKUST MBA mission is to inspire and transform individuals to be future business leaders for Asia and the world. We embrace diversity and are looking for ambitious and open-minded candidates with a passion to contribute. It is the first day of orientation. Please introduce yourself to your classmates, highlighting what drives you in your personal and professional life.
Word limit: 500 words
Essay 2:Tell us about your post-MBA goals and based on that, why is the HKUST MBA the ideal program for you and how do you plan to engage and enrich our community?
Word limit: 500 words
Essay 3: How do you plan to finance your MBA?
Word limit: 500 words
